Sadly, it's impossible to port the code to arduino due to it using a serial to USB chip. It doesn't run pure USB which is what is required to make the exploit work. Unless a custom USB driver is written for arduino and is used in conjunction with a usb controller attached to the arduino. Something way outside of my knowledge base and to be honest, way too fiddly to be of any use to anyone really.

I've just ordered a teensy++v2.0 so when that comes I'll be able to get the hack up and running with minimal effort.

AppleQueso wrote:I wonder if we would've seen this pop up so fast if it weren't for Sony's removing OtherOS?
I doubt it, people have been working behind the scenes on a LV2 (GameOS) level exploit for a while. It was inevitable. The OtherOS exploit was never really that useful since it was only useable inside OtherOS. It could never give anybody access to GameOS since the system required a reboot therefore losing the hack. For the LV0/LV1 hack to work (IE GeoHot OtherOS) it needed code to be running to peek the memory values then inject unintended values (by pulsing the memory lines on the motherboard) into valid memory, therefore bypassing the hypervisors security, and since you can't run unsigned code on GameOS without being in Dev Mode it would be impossible to hack the hypervisor whilst in GameOS, perhaps you could cause the system to hang but whether or not it would allow for a stack smash or similar attack is very unlikely. At the end of the day the OtherOS exploit is a very brute force attack. It's not elegant enough to be useful for a lot of people.
